American Siblings in a Family Divided by Law

Your browser doesn’t support HTML5 audio

We meet a family divided by immigration laws. Four kids, all U.S. citizens with a mother without papers who, after trying to get legal status the "right way," was forced to wait 10 years in Mexico.
